Buenos Aires: San Telmo
San Telmo is a district of Buenos Aires The Independencia station, on the E and C lines, will get you to Avenida 9 de Julio and Avenida Independencia, on the edge of San Telmo. Follow Independencia for six blocks and then swing right for another four to get to Plaza Dorrego.

- When visiting the traditional fair in San Telmo, which mostly goes along «Defensa», try to go to The «paseo San Lorenzo» which intersects with Defensa at number 755. It is a tiny street and has the oldest still existing house of Buenos Aires. You will notice the murals and the odd layout of … • Marcial W.
